Output 99006e5c1d6a63052c84cfd02f1f3012656f2f3b77bf4a30c98ce3bdfe72b14a:0

value
320548023
script pubkey
OP_0 OP_PUSHBYTES_20 b91bc40aae3f2417ce31cd1a9ee4f7eb28ccb912
address
bc1qhydugz4w8ujp0n33e5dfae8hav5vewgjhmctaa
transaction
99006e5c1d6a63052c84cfd02f1f3012656f2f3b77bf4a30c98ce3bdfe72b14a
spent
true